Steadfast

Burn the land, boil the sea,
Sew the fields with salt and weed,
But you can't take my spirit from me.

Slash my eyes so I can't see,
Crush my home and family,
But you can't take my spirit from me.

Grind the dirt into the sky,
Chain my wings so I can't fly,
But you can't take my spirit from me.

Flood the cities, spread disease,
Enslave the people and their dreams,
But you can't take my spirit from me.

Rip out everything I love,
Rain down bullets from above,
But you can't take my spirit from me.

Wear us down with foreign war,
Leave us on a foreign shore,
But you can't take our spirit from us.

I don't need land, don't need sea,
Don't need blue skies to be free,
While it's just my spirit and me.
